We just wrapped up a lovely stay at Sadie’s by the Sea. The staff were friendly and helpful, the restaurant delicious, the second floor views of the harbor and location unbeatable. Contrary to other reviews here, our room was clean and we encountered no questionable fees. In fact, we had to move to the Tradewinds after 4 nights at Sadie’s due to business, and our bathroom at Sadie’s was much cleaner. The airport shuttle was there when we exited customs. The driver was very nice, sharing local places of interest as we drove by and sharing bits of local cultural information. If you want to feel like you are experiencing more of the real island life, stay here. It’s an easy walk to the NOAA Ocean Visitor Center for the Marine Sanctuary and about a mile walk to the National Park Visitor Center. With a car, it’s an easy drive to National Park trailheads and amazing snorkeling. I rated 4 instead of 5 due to 3 issues. First, we did not use their beach. They do not keep it clean from trash people leave behind or that washed up, so it wasn’t very pleasant. The views of the harbor and seeing turtles swimming by were a definite advantage to being near the water. For snorkeling, we instead went to beaches in the National Marine sanctuary where you simply ask permission from the locals who happily agree to let you use the beach as long as it’s not a Sunday. The second issue was that the room was dark. This was probably the biggest issue for me. The lamps provided simply didn’t give enough light, and there are no overhead fixtures. Third, they should state upfront if there is no hot water. We aren’t sure if this was a temporary issue or they don’t have any. It was fine; it’s really hot and humid on the island and a cool shower can be nice after a hike. But it would have been nice to know. If you need a fancy hotel with a lot of amenities, you may want to stay in Tafuna. But if you want a more scenic experience where you can talk to locals and enjoy the island, go with Sadie’s by the Sea.

Sadie's is an older hotel that needs some TLC. Since your flight to American Samoa arrives at 9:30 at night on Mondays and departs at 11:30 pm on Thursdays, they pick you up and drop you off at the airport. Everything closes down on Sundays in Samoa, so don' t call, no one will pick up the phone. Sadie's is the only hotel on the island that has a private beach and a pool. The beach water was very warm. There is also a restaurant on the premises. Most of the beaches in Samoa are private, if a beach is a must, stay here. Is this a 5 star resort, no, there aren't any in Samoa. Most visitors visit American Samoa to visit the National Park, the island is not set up for tourism. We enjoyed our stay here and would recommend it. Stay on the 2nd floor for a better view of the ocean. There are not any elevators.
